Two-hour guided night walk starting at 6 PM from Pizza Mail — witness the Osa Peninsula's unique nocturnal wildlife.
A guided night walk in Puerto Jiménez focusing on the rich biodiversity of the Osa Peninsula. Starting at 6 PM from Pizza Mail, the tour lasts approximately two hours under the cover of darkness, offering a chance to see the jungle's nocturnal inhabitants while the village rests.
Guides will provide quality headlights for better visibility. If transport is required, arrangements can be made for an additional cost. Expect to encounter species that are primarily active at night, making the walk a fascinating addition to any daytime adventures in the area.
